Growing Conditions
Ideal Light Conditions π
Philodendron 'Chocolate' thrives in bright, indirect sunlight. While it can tolerate lower light levels, be prepared for slower growth.
Temperature and Humidity Requirements π‘οΈ
This plant prefers a cozy temperature range of 65Β°F to 80Β°F (18Β°C to 27Β°C). High humidityβideally 50% or moreβwill keep your Philodendron happy and healthy.
Choosing the Right Location π‘
When deciding where to place your plant, consider both indoor and outdoor options. Indoors, position it near windows with filtered light; outdoors, opt for shaded areas that shield it from harsh direct sunlight.
Soil and Planting Techniques
π± Soil Preparation and Type
For your Philodendron 'Chocolate', well-draining soil is crucial. It promotes aeration and moisture retention, ensuring your plant thrives.
A recommended soil mix includes peat-based components combined with perlite or orchid bark. This blend provides the right balance of nutrients and drainage.
πΏ Planting Techniques
When planting, ensure the root ball is level with the soil surface. This positioning helps the plant establish itself more effectively.
Spacing is also important; allow for climbing or spreading by placing plants ideally 12-18 inches apart. This gives them room to grow without competing for resources.
πͺ΄ Container Selection and Drainage
Choosing the right container can make a significant difference. Options include plastic, ceramic, or terracotta, each with its own benefits.
Ensure your container has drainage holes. This prevents water accumulation, which can lead to root rot and other issues.

Watering and Fertilizing
π§ Watering Frequency and Techniques
Watering your Philodendron 'Chocolate' is straightforward. The general rule is to water when the top inch of soil feels dry.
You can choose between bottom watering and top watering methods. Bottom watering allows the plant to absorb moisture from the roots up, while top watering is simply pouring water directly onto the soil until it drains out of the bottom.
π± Best Fertilizers
For optimal growth, use a balanced liquid fertilizer during the growing season. This will provide essential nutrients that your plant craves.
Apply the fertilizer every 4-6 weeks during spring and summer. This routine will keep your Philodendron thriving and vibrant.
π¨ Signs of Overwatering and Underwatering
Recognizing the signs of overwatering is crucial. Look for yellowing leaves and mushy roots, which indicate that your plant is drowning.
On the flip side, underwatering shows up as wilting and crispy leaf edges. Adjust your watering schedule accordingly to keep your plant healthy and happy.

Pruning and Maintenance
πͺ΄ When and How to Prune
Pruning your Philodendron 'Chocolate' is essential for its health and appearance. The best time to prune is in spring or early summer when the plant is actively growing.
Use clean, sharp scissors to remove any dead or damaged leaves. This not only enhances the plant's look but also encourages new growth.
π§ Importance of Regular Maintenance
Regular maintenance is key to a thriving plant. It promotes bushier growth and helps prevent diseases from taking hold.
Routine checks for pests and overall plant health can save you from bigger issues down the line. A little attention goes a long way!
π± Tips for Promoting Healthy Growth
Encouraging your Philodendron to climb can significantly enhance its growth. Use stakes or trellises for support, allowing the plant to reach its full potential.
Additionally, regularly rotating the plant ensures even light exposure. This simple practice can lead to more balanced growth and a healthier plant overall.

Common Challenges and Solutions
π Identifying and Managing Pests
Common Pests
Pests can be a real headache for your Philodendron 'Chocolate.'
- Spider Mites: Look for webbing and stippled leaves, which are telltale signs of these tiny invaders.
- Aphids: These pests often cluster on new growth, sucking the sap and weakening your plant.
Pest Control Methods
Managing pests doesnβt have to be a chore.
- Organic Options: Neem oil and insecticidal soap are effective and safe choices.
- Regular Monitoring: Keep an eye on your plant for early signs of trouble; catching pests early makes all the difference.
π¦ Addressing Common Diseases
Root Rot
Root rot can sneak up on you, especially if you're not careful with watering.
- Symptoms: If your plant is wilting despite adequate watering, it might be suffering from root rot.
- Prevention: Ensure your soil is well-draining and stick to proper watering techniques to keep those roots healthy.
π± Troubleshooting Growth Issues
Yellowing Leaves
Yellowing leaves can be frustrating, but they often signal underlying issues.
- Causes: This can stem from overwatering, nutrient deficiencies, or poor light conditions.
- Solutions: Adjust your watering schedule and check the soil quality to get your plant back on track.

Additional Care Tips
π¦οΈ Seasonal Care Adjustments
Caring for your Philodendron 'Chocolate' varies with the seasons. In winter, reduce watering and fertilizing as the plant enters dormancy; this helps prevent root rot and keeps your plant healthy.
During the summer, increase humidity and watering frequency. This is when your plant is actively growing, and it thrives with a little extra care.
πͺ΄ Container Gardening
Container gardening offers fantastic benefits for your Philodendron 'Chocolate.' It provides mobility, allowing you to reposition your plant for optimal light and temperature.
Choosing the right container size is crucial. Ensure itβs appropriate for your plant's size and growth habits to promote healthy development and avoid root crowding.
